Секторен анализ на търговията на дребно в България: фокус върху подотрасли с хранителни и нехранителни стоки
Sectoral Analysis of the Retail Trade in Bulgaria: Focus on Food and Non-Food Subsectors

Summary/Abstract: This study presents a sectoral analysis of the retail trade in Bulgaria, focusing on two key subsectors: retail trade in non-specialized stores with a predominance of food products (NACE 4710) and specialized retail trade of non-food household and consumer goods (NACE 4750). The objective is to identify the structural differences, economic dynamics, financial sustainability, and market prospects of the two segments under the same macroeconomic conditions. The analysis includes an assessment of the market environment, competitive factors, margin structure, inventory turnover, capital intensity, and sensitivity to the economic cycle. Special attention is given to the impact of inflation, changes in consumer behaviour, digitalization, and the rise of e-commerce on pricing strategies, revenues, and profitability. The main risks and entry barriers are compared, including regulatory requirements, supplier bargaining power, ESG factors, and competitive pressure from international chains and online models. The study highlights that although both subsectors belong to the same industry, they respond differently to external shocks and follow distinct adaptation trajectories. The conclusions provide a basis for further research and support decision-making by investors, creditors, and management structures operating in the Bulgarian retail sector.
